Yeşilay recently added a new one to its ever increasing

international activities. Yeşilay was involved in the

process of preparatory works for the United Nations

General Assembly Special Session on international

drug policies, known as UNGASS 2016. Thus, Yeşilay has

become part of the UN Civil Society Task Force (CSTF),

which consists of 26 organizations, as the regional

representative for Eastern Europe and Central Asia. The

Task Force is formed of organizations active on the field

and internationally.

The Civil Society Task Force aims at assuring the

comprehensive, structured, meaningful and balanced

participation of the civil society in the UNGASS 2016

process. For this purpose activities and works will be

conducted in 9 different regions during the preparatory

process. The Task Force will actively collaborate with

institutions such as the UN Office on Drugs and Crime

and the Commission on Narcotic Drugs.

Yeşilay will represent Eastern Europe and Central

Asia in the task force that was formed to coordinate

the works between UN and civil society during

the preparatory process for the 2016 UN General

Assembly Special Session on international drug

policy which will be attended by many heads of state

and is predicted to bring about significant changes in

drug policy.

Yeşilay will be at the center of the works to be

conducted in Eastern Europe and Central Asia as well

as the procedures carried out at the UN.

The first meeting within the scope of UNGASS 2016 is

planned to be held in Vienna, in March. Subsequently,

working meetings will be realized in various countries

and international drug policy documents will be

prepared.
